Transaction fd3fc286841ccd2a87cf1590351a1ba71345e62423e3a6b63b11fe5349417ee4
1 Input
1 Output
-
fd3fc286841ccd2a87cf1590351a1ba71345e62423e3a6b63b11fe5349417ee4:0
- value
- 135529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 383a390b020b7815058038418104fe19be375417 OP_EQUAL
- address
- 36pKWgLRaxEvxYdGQAxZb5fmpeQL7bxNVB